Frank Sherard was born in Northwest Missouri. He received his undergraduate degree from TCU. Frank went to Seminary in Kansas City at Saint Paul School of Theology. He begin ministry in 1994. He has served churches in Missouri & Louisiana. Today he is a New Church Planter for Lafayette, Louisiana. He is married to Ashley who is also the Co-Church Planter in his current call. He has three daughters: Lennon - 7, McCartney - 5, and Harrison - 4. This week in John 20:19-31 much of the focus over the years has been on Thomas being absent from Jesus appearing to the others who gathered behind locked doors. From this very passage of scripture is coined the popular and historical phrase, “doubting Thomas.” The AMAZING part of Jesus’ appearance to the others isn’t that Thomas wasn’t there and was so blunt about having to physically see and touch Jesus to believe. The AMAZING storyline here is that Jesus commissioned ALL who were (and I would say ARE) gathered in Jesus’ name to GO….Go and forgive. Jesus “breathed on them the Holy Spirit” so that they could forgive or retain the sins of any. That same Holy Spirit or Advocate is with us all today.
